Sri Lanka, April 20 -- Citing a lack of transparency, the government has decided to conduct an audit into the expenses incurred by two administrations in Parliament over the last 10 years.

Speaker Dr. Jagath Wickramaratne has reportedly already instructed the Auditor General to provide an urgent audit report on this matter.

The Speaker's Office stated that the Speaker was dissatisfied with the expense records following issues that arose concerning deficit spending in Parliament on the 8th and 9th.

They also noted that parliamentary audit work had been carried out by several private institutions during that period.
